Output 6102e66ae2754835f7ad820eec37e2ab4c83671db76b0f1d203afae5ec458c61:3

value
18450
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 36f28fbc29bf3a1967cb6b90ab0f4853bbe7d13d19fb8e742967d00803313960
address
bc1pxmegl0pfhuapje7tdwg2kr6g2wa705far8acuapfvlgqsqe389sqljfydj
transaction
6102e66ae2754835f7ad820eec37e2ab4c83671db76b0f1d203afae5ec458c61
spent
true